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2004.11.14;
Скачать: CL | DM;

Вниз

Номер записи в отфильтрованой таблице???   Найти похожие ветки 

 
cad2206   (2004-10-18 10:41) [0]

Вот код:

...
Form1.Table1.Filter:="Datapv = "+ QuotedStr(DateToStr(Now));
Form1.Table1.Filtered:=true;
Form1.Table1.Last;
m:=0;
 For i:=1 to Form1.Table1.RecordCount do
  begin
  inc(m);
  if Form1.Table1.FieldByName("DS").AsString="Вход" then
   begin
    fl:=1;
    n:=Form1.Table1.RecNo;
...
Свойство Form1.Table1.RecordCount дает количество записей в отфильтрованной таблице, а свойство Form1.Table1.RecNo возвращает номер записи как неотфильтрованной таблицы. Как быть?


 
Johnmen ©   (2004-10-18 10:51) [1]

Отказаться от этого, как не имеющего смысла...


 
cad2206   (2004-10-18 11:05) [2]

дык нужно очень


 
Johnmen ©   (2004-10-18 11:17) [3]

для ча ?


 
cad2206   (2004-10-18 11:23) [4]

Нужно запомнить, на какой записи остановился цикл, потом в этой же таблице проводить другой и по его окончанию возвращаться к нужной записи. Вот!


 
Sergey13 ©   (2004-10-18 11:26) [5]

2[4] cad2206   (18.10.04 11:23)
Для этого обычно пользуются первичными ключами.


 
Johnmen ©   (2004-10-18 11:29) [6]

Если подразумевается набор данных, то для этого пользуются закладками. TBookmark.


 
cad2206   (2004-10-18 11:33) [7]

Просьба, приведите пожалуйста ответ, приближенный к коду.


 
ЮЮ ©   (2004-10-18 11:46) [8]

А ещё лучше, ИМХО, внешний цикл - один DataSet, а внутренний - другой, связанный с первым.


 
Johnmen ©   (2004-10-18 11:49) [9]

>Просьба, приведите пожалуйста ответ, приближенный к коду.

Он есть в хелпе. GetBookmark+F1


 
Ильш   (2004-10-18 12:13) [10]

Form1.Table1.RecordCount
Form1.Table1.RecNo
раньше пользовался - сколько времени потерял зря уфффф :(((
больше к ним не подойду к ним!! фиииии :)))))
читайте теорию - например ВАМ надо искать в таких книгах слово "ПЕРВИЧНЫЙ КЛЮЧ"!!!
а еще учите SQL !!!
и таких вопросов не будет больше никогда !!!
и да прибудет с вами Дейт :)))))



Страницы: 1 вся ветка

Текущий архив: 2004.11.14;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.039 c
3-1098091565
Belkova
2004-10-18 13:26
2004.11.14
Поиск


3-1098082300
Леван
2004-10-18 10:51
2004.11.14
Что за чушь?


1-1099393717
Pentium133
2004-11-02 14:08
2004.11.14
Не вызывается Change! Что делать?


3-1097824819
NorthMan
2004-10-15 11:20
2004.11.14
Запрос из консольного приложения


3-1097576859
Санёк
2004-10-12 14:27
2004.11.14
Сравнение двух записей